It is occasionally desired to measure how long it takes for a certain embedded code to execute on given target hardware. For example, real-time applications need to execute in a time period that doesn’t exceed the periodic time (program cycle time), otherwise, a timer-over run error is generated. Another reason why we need to know the execution time is to compare the computational load of different algorithms that perform the same task to know their advantage with respect to computational load and execution speed.
For those who use a Model-based approach and specifically use Simulink for programming real-time application and need a simple way to follow, this short guide is given. Because the Simulink coder keeps them relatively apart from generating the code, they may face difficulties in such measurement while those who code directly with C in code composer studio may not face this difficulty!
